The appearance was a dark brown close to black color with a one finger white to off white foamy head that dissipated at a nice pace. Semi-sticky lace. The aroma starts with some roasty coffee beans, light sweet sharp cocoa beans, some toast. The flavor leans sweet with the roast making a good effort to balance nicely. Sly roasty malt aftertaste with a nice balanced finish. On the palate, this one sat about a light to medium on the body with a fair sessionability about it. Carbonation feels good for the style and for me. Overall, very nicely done stout that I would have again.

Poured into a 20 oz glass on draft at The Holy Grail. Pours a very slick black with a massive 3 inch light brown head that leaves behind fantastic lace as it slowly settles into a thick layer of khaki bubbles.

Smell is loaded fresh black coffee, biscuit, milk chocolate, vanilla, and toffee.

Taste follows first comes the expresso, vanilla, oats, with grainy biscuit, toffee, caramel, and dark chocolate in the finish.

Mouthfeel is a little bigger than medium, creamy as hell, mild carbonation as expected, maybe a little dry, and you would not guess this was 8% ABV.

Overall this is a very nice coffee stout, that really shines once it warms. Will get this again before it is gone.
